We compared two laptop CPUs: Intel Core i5 1030NG7 with 4 cores 1.1GHz and AMD Ryzen AI Max Pro 390 with 12 cores 3.2G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i5 1030NG7 's Advantages
Lower TDP (10W vs 55W)
AMD Ryzen AI Max Pro 390 's Advantages
Released 4 years and 10 months late
Higher specification of memory (8000 vs 3733)
Larger memory bandwidth (256GB/s vs 58.3GB/s)
Newer PCIe version (4 vs 3.0)
Higher base frequency (3.2GHz vs 1.1GHz)
Larger L3 cache size (64MB vs 6MB)
More modern manufacturing process (4nm vs 10nm)
